首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将PL SQL中相同列的值在2天内进行比较

在PL/SQL中,可以使用各种方法来比较相同列的值在2天内的情况。以下是一种可能的解决方案:

  1. 首先,我们需要一个包含相同列的表。假设我们有一个名为"my_table"的表,其中包含一个名为"column_name"的列。
  2. 接下来,我们可以使用PL/SQL中的日期函数来获取当前日期和两天前的日期。例如,使用SYSDATE函数获取当前日期,使用SYSDATE-2函数获取两天前的日期。
  3. 然后,我们可以使用SELECT语句从表中选择具有相同列值的记录,并将其与当前日期和两天前的日期进行比较。可以使用WHERE子句和比较运算符来实现这一点。例如,可以使用"column_name = value"来选择具有特定列值的记录。
  4. 最后,我们可以将结果打印出来或将其存储在变量中以供后续处理。

这是一个简单的示例代码,演示了如何在PL/SQL中比较相同列的值在2天内的情况:

代码语言:txt
复制
DECLARE
  current_date DATE := SYSDATE;
  two_days_ago DATE := SYSDATE - 2;
  column_value VARCHAR2(100);
BEGIN
  SELECT column_name INTO column_value
  FROM my_table
  WHERE column_name = value
    AND column_date >= two_days_ago
    AND column_date <= current_date;
  
  DBMS_OUTPUT.PUT_LINE('The column value is: ' || column_value);
EXCEPTION
  WHEN NO_DATA_FOUND THEN
    DBMS_OUTPUT.PUT_LINE('No matching records found.');
END;

请注意,上述代码中的"value"应替换为您要比较的具体列值。此外,您还可以根据需要进行修改和扩展。

对于PL/SQL中相同列的值在2天内进行比较的应用场景,一个常见的例子是日志分析。通过比较相同列的值,可以检测到在两天内重复出现的日志事件,从而帮助识别潜在的问题或异常情况。

腾讯云提供了多个与云计算相关的产品,例如云数据库 TencentDB、云服务器 CVM、云原生容器服务 TKE 等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分33秒

088.sync.Map的比较相关方法

5分26秒

国产功率器件IGBT模块封装与测试,IGBT测试座socket-关键测试连接器

2分32秒

052.go的类型转换总结

7分8秒

059.go数组的引入

1分7秒

PS小白教程:如何在Photoshop中给风景照添加光线效果?

16分8秒

Tspider分库分表的部署 - MySQL

1分16秒

振弦式渗压计的安装方式及注意事项

1分30秒

基于强化学习协助机器人系统在多个操纵器之间负载均衡。

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

1时5分

云拨测多方位主动式业务监控实战

领券